Orb of AnnulmentStack Size: 20Removes a random modifier from an itemRight click this item then left click on a magic or rare item to apply it. Removes 20% Quality applied by Catalysts on use. Shift click to unstack.
Acquisition Drop level: 35 Orbs of Annulment are uncommon currency items that can be dropped by slain monsters, chests, and destructible containers. They also drop from Arcanist's Strongboxes. They can also be obtained by combining Annulment ShardsAnnulment ShardStack Size: 20A stack of 20 shards becomes an Orb of Annulment., which are dropped exclusively by Harbingers.Vendor Offer 1x Scroll FragmentMetadata Item class: Currency Item Metadata ID: Metadata/Items/Currency/CurrencyRemoveMod
The Orb of Annulment is a currency item that can be used to remove a random modifier from a magic or rare item.

Spending
Orbs of Annulment are used in item crafting, and are especially useful to improve good items with one undesired modifier. Using these orbs is risky though, since the removed modifier is chosen completely randomly.
Interactions with Affixes
It has been hypothesised by the community that the chance of removing a mod from an item is not equal for every mod. It seems that the chance a mod is removed is seeded by the rarity of the mod. (e.g When using an Orb of Annulment on "Thunderhand's Quartz Wand of the Student" then you are more likely to remove the "of the Student" suffix because it is more common than the "Thunderhand's" prefix.
